WSUS at multiple sites and one master to approve

Hi Guys , 

If this has been answered, please forgive me and direct me to that. i have multiple sites wsus installed (sites are connected via vpn). at the moment each sites has it own servers of wsus and in GP ,sites OU to report to its own server. What I like to do is have one master at one site and approve the updates at that server. clients download the updates from it own servers. not from other sites. then again that servers on the branch offices will download updates from Microsoft rather than Master server to save the vpn bandwidth. 

how can i approach that

You can set up WSUS hierarchy with a root server and a number of downstream replica servers. In this scenario, updates are approved on the root server and information is replicated down to replica servers. WSYS can also be configured to synchronize metadata only and let clients fetch content for approved updates directly from windows update site, so that you can avoid additional load on inter-site links.
